What are your thoughts on the A 100 2.8 macro lens? I have the A 100 F4 lens and was wondering if the 2.8 might be an upgrade.
The A100/2.8 Macro is / has become a bit of a cult lens due to its relative rarity as an optical design that only ran through one season. It has a very exposed rear element which can make it prone to sensor reflection. Saying that it can produce a very nice image







Tactile wise the focusing action is absolutely sublime.
